The NSSA National Banquet was last night awarding the finalists from the 2-week long event. The Nationals is by far the most prestigious American amateur event and could be argued for the world. DVS riders posted strong showings this year with the standout performance being put in by Granger Larsen (top photo). This was Granger's last year competing in Nationals before moving onto the WQS tour. Granger made 3 finals, winning the Explorer Juniors & Men's and coming 2nd in the Open Men's. Ezekiel Lau (middle photo) placed 2nd in Explorer Boys and Coco Ho (bottom photo) placed 2nd in High School Women. Congrats to all who made and competed in this years Nationals and especially to the DVS team who put in a strong showing.

Kekoa Bacalso powered his way through a stacked field to win the WQS 6*Prime Srilankan Airlines Pro yesterday off Pasta Point in the Madlives. Bacalso has been treading water on the WQS since he won the 2006 World Junior Championship, got his big breakthrough with his 1st major WQS win! Surf was about as good as it gets for a contest with 4-5ft. reeling lefts. Bacalso pockets $15,000 and 3000 points for his win and rockets up to #5 on the QS ratings.
